Argos in Cappadocia is the result of a labor of love 26 years in the making and now a world-class hotel that exceeds the expectations of the most sophisticated of international travelers. Perched high above the village of Uchisar, a ten-minute walk away, the hotel is perfectly located for the exploration of all of Cappadocia's. A mysterious, even unearthly expanse of ravines, canyons, mountains, and valleys, it was formed by millions of years of soft volcanic lava and ash.

It began with the vision of turning a complex of ancient dwellings into a world-class luxury hotel. The dream was enhanced with the discovery of the ruins of Bezirhane, a 1500-year-old rock-hewn monastery and later hostel for camel caravans on the legendary Silk Road.  Finally, Argos in Cappadocia opened its doors as an elegant masterpiece – a highly imaginative boutique hotel and concert hall that reinterprets the rich traditions of the past for today's discerning travelers in breathtaking fashion.

The hotel's accommodations are offered in several styles, from standard rooms to Tıraz Jacuzzi Suite with private Turkish bath and jacuzzi and splendid suites with private in-suite swimming pool. The rooms uniquely situated in seven restored "mansions" connected by underground tunnels and pay tribute, in design, to the region's ancient underground architecture.

Local Area Attractions

Key Sites / Activities in the Area


• Goreme Open Air Museum (a UNESCO World Heritage site), with many ancient churches, chapels, and frescoes
• Underground cities (Kaymakli, Derinkuyu, and others)
• Uchisar Castle, overlooking much of the region
• Valleys (Zelve, Ihlara and others)
• Mt. Erciyes, Mt. Hasan and Mt. Gullu, three volcanoes that, 60 million years ago, erupted to form the volcanic rock of Cappadocia
• Pigeon Valley with its cliffside carved pigeon houses
• Hot air ballooning
• Underground wineries
• Outdoor sports: hiking, horseback riding, mountain biking
• Artisan centers: Avanos pottery, the center of terracotta art since 3000 BC, rug ateliers and jewelry
